- Как быстро очистить кэш на смартфоне Андроид
- Для чего удалять кэш на Андроид
- Может ли очистка кэша навредить устройству
- Каким бывает кэш
- Быстрая очистка кэша на Андроид: лучшие способы
- Очистка кэш-файлов на Андроид смартфоне вручную
- Очистка кэш-файлов определенных приложений
- Очистка кэш-файлов при помощи сторонних программ
- Clean Master
- Другие приложения
- Как очистить кэш на телефоне Android
- Что такое кэш и как он работает
- Есть ли смысл в очистке кэша
- Встроенные методы
- Удаляем кэш в диспетчере приложений
- Пользуемся файловым менеджером
- Пользуемся программами для очистки
- Заключение
Как быстро очистить кэш на смартфоне Андроид
Устройство с OS Android иногда само очищается. Однако оно делает это недостаточно качественно. В этой статье рассказано о том, как в считанные минуты очистить весь или определенный кэш на гаджете.
Для начала давайте узнаем, что такое cache-файлы на операционной системе Андроид. Это частицы информации, которые генерируются различными приложениями при их работе. Они ускоряют работу этих приложений, потому что ПО создаёт файлы только один раз. В дальнейшем с них считывается информация.
Чтобы лучше понять, приведем пример. Программы-галереи создают эскизы (иконки) фотографий, сохраняют их. В дальнейшем процессор не будет нагружаться, чтобы создать еще раз. Только, если владелец добавил новые картинки. В общем, они служат в качестве носителей информации. Когда приложению нужно что-нибудь отобразить, оно открывает это в КЭШ-файлах. Если бы их не существовало, то ПО каждый раз бы создавало их заново, затем открывало. Это замедляет работу телефона. Однако нужно время от времени очищать эти файлы.
Для чего удалять кэш на Андроид
Казалось бы, зачем их очищать, если они ускоряют работу смартфона? Дело в том, что кроме этого преимущества есть один существенный недостаток. Со временем они накапливаются, их становится все больше, следовательно, количество свободного места на смартфоне уменьшается. Некоторые программы способны полностью засорить Android устройство.
Проблема в том, что большинство приложений создают эти файлы, некоторые из них весят много. Со временем программное обеспечение уже в них не нуждаются, но кэш так и остается в памяти телефона.
Чтобы лучше понять принцип работы кэш-файлов, рассмотрим следующие примеры. Если на устройстве установлено 20 приложений, которыми владелец регулярно пользуется, то со временем размер кэша в совокупности будет равен 5-6 гигабайтам, а иногда больше. Позже программное обеспечение обновляется. Программы меняют принцип работы. Следовательно, создают новые носители информации. Однако старые никуда не деваются. Это похоже на снежный ком, который катится вниз и разрастается.
Может ли очистка кэша навредить устройству
Стоит отметить сразу, что очистка не повредит устройству. Однако при выполнении следующих действий стоит учитывать одно — все данные приложения пропадут. К примеру, игра полностью обнулится, удалятся все рекорды. Сохраните все необходимые данные перед тем, как проводить очистку.
Каким бывает кэш
Существует три основных вида кэш-файлов на устройстве с ОС Андроид:
- файлы от скачанных приложений;
- созданный системными файлами;
- Dalvik-кэш.
Первый тип — это те файлы, которые были описаны выше. Хранилище информации, которые создают установленные приложения на операционной системе Андроид. К ним относятся разные игры, браузеры, например, из Плей Маркета. Они содержат данные, которые необходимы программе для быстрой работы. ПО выгружает информацию в нужный момент, использует ее.
Второй — кэш, созданный системными приложениями. Что за системные приложения? Это программное обеспечение, идущее вместе с прошивкой Андроид. Это ПО создаёт для себя носители информации, что воспроизвести данные, когда это нужно.
Многие пользователи ОС Android никогда не слышали о Dalvik. Это своего рода регистр на смартфоне. Он также создает буфер-файлы для оптимизации операционной системы, а также для быстрого открытия и функционирования специальных программ. Они невидимы для пользователя, их список нигде нельзя увидеть. Для этого нужно специальное ПО.
Быстрая очистка кэша на Андроид: лучшие способы
Существует два методы очистки буфер-файлов на операционной системе Android: при помощи системной возможности (утилиты, предусмотренной разработчиком), либо посредством установки необходимого приложения из APK-файла или маркета.
Сразу стоит подметить, что самый безопасный способ — первый. С помощью встроенной программы можно быстро и легко удалить кеш-файлы. Разработчик предусмотрел то, что некоторые носители информации нельзя удалять. Следовательно, ПО настроено так, что важные файлы буду в безопасности. Кроме того, если скачивать сторонние приложения из малоизвестных источников, то есть шанс заражения вирусами.
Очистка кэш-файлов на Андроид смартфоне вручную
Это наименее радикальный, но более долгий способ, так как все нужно делать вручную. Как это сделать? Чтобы легко освободить память на телефоне, выполните все действия согласно следующей инструкции:
- Откройте меню настроек любым удобным способом.
- Пролистайте вниз, найдите раздел «Устройство» или «Смартфон». Нажмите на «Память телефона».
- Далее нужно зайти в меню «Кэш». Там будет функция «Очистить кэш». Выберите ее.
- После загрузки подтвердите свои действия, нажав на соответствующую кнопку.
- Очистка может занять некоторое время. Чем реже чистился кэш, тем дольше будет длиться процесс. Спустя несколько секунд или минут окно закроется. Количество доступной памяти увеличится, а размер кэш-файлов уменьшится.
Обратите внимание, что этот способ удаляет буфер-файлы со всех приложений.
Очистка кэш-файлов определенных приложений
Бывает, что только одна программа занимает много места, а удалять данные всех не хочется. В таком случае стоит воспользоваться следующей инструкцией. Таким образом можно выборочно очищать приложения:
- Откройте меню настроек.
- Зайдите в управление внутренней памятью (пункт «Память»).
- Затем в список приложений.
- Далее нужно открыть вкладку со всеми программами.
- Пролистайте и найдите нужное приложение. Если есть поиск, то воспользуйтесь этой функцией.
- В открывшемся меню нужно нажать на кнопку «Удалить КЭШ» или «Стереть данные». В разных устройствах надпись отличается.
- Подтвердите выбор, нажав на «ОК».
- Через несколько минут приложение сбросится до начальных настроек.
Имейте в виду, что после удаления информации программного обеспечения, оно запросит повторную авторизацию при последующем открытии. К примеру, в приложении банка нужно будет заново войти в учетную запись или добавить карту. Поэтому перед очисткой нужно вспомнить логин и пароль, а также по возможности сохранить данные.
Очистка кэш-файлов при помощи сторонних программ
На некоторых устройствах система настолько засорена, что нужно скачивать сторонние приложения, и проводить очистку с их помощью.
Clean Master
Эта программа считается самой распространенной для улучшения быстродействия, очистки и оптимизации Андроид устройства. Инструкция:
- Загрузите приложение с Плей Маркета. Дождитесь окончания установки.
- Откройте Clean Master. В меню есть 4 основные опции: junk files, phone boost, antivirus, app manager. Нам нужна первая. На иконке изображена корзина.
- Выберите опцию, дождитесь окончания анализа мусора в системных файлах смартфона.
- После завершения отобразится количество кэша, которое можно удалить без вреда телефону.
- Нажмите на кнопку «Clean Junk». Начнется очистка.
Интерфейс приложения прост в усвоении. Кроме того, в нем есть множество различных функций: очистка уведомлений, управление программами и пр.
Другие приложения
Существуют другие приложения. Вот список лучших:
Эти программы самые эффективные и распространенные среди Андроид пользователей. В основном, отзывы положительные. Бывают проблемы с ранними версиями OS.
Таким образом можно очистить кэш на Android устройстве.
Источник
Как очистить кэш на телефоне Android
Далее подробнее разберемся в том, что такое кэш и какими способами можно его удалить на телефоне/планшете под управлением Android.
Наверняка многие замечали, как со временем количество свободной памяти на любом устройстве Android уменьшается, даже если мы не устанавливаем новые приложения. Это связано с тем, что любая программа использует кэширование. Простыми словами, кэширование – это процесс, при котором приложение создает специальный буфер данных. Этот буфер программа часто использует при работе в дальнейшем, что позволяет ей не подгружать постоянно различные данные, например, из сети. Нужная информация просто размещается во внутреннем хранилище в виде файла.
Сам кэш-файл можно спокойно удалять – это никак не навредит программе и не нарушит ее работоспособность. Разве что запускаться она может после этого значительно дольше. Используется данная технология не только в приложениях, но и в базах данных (сокращает задержки во время доступа к каким-либо ячейкам), в интернете (ускорение получения контента с серверов и более быстрый обмен информацией) и не только.
Что такое кэш и как он работает
Вообще, существует несколько видов кэшей. Например, каждый современный процессор, на котором работают устройства Android, оснащается небольшим запасом кэш-памяти. Этот запас размещается прямо в процессоре, точнее, в системе на чипе (SoC), на которой располагаются остальные элементы: GPU (графическое ядро), ISP (процессор обработки изображений), сетевой модем и прочие. Кэш-память процессора является самой быстрой и ограниченной определенным небольшим объемом.
В нашем же случае речь идет о локальных кэш-файлах, которые создаются во внутренней памяти устройства и хранят информацию, часто используемую тем или иным приложением. Наглядный пример можно привести с браузером Google Chrome (или любым другим). Когда мы пытаемся перейти на какую-либо веб-страницу, браузер сначала пробегается по всем файлам и пробует найти готовую загруженную версию сайта. Если он ее находит – просто подгружает сайт на ее основе, не делая сетевых запросов, что экономит трафик.
В том случае, если браузеру не удается найти копию страницы на локальном диске (внутреннем накопителе), он загружает ее, как обычно, используя сеть Интернет. И если в настройках включена специальная функция, то страница будет сохранена в памяти в виде небольшого кэш-файла.
Еще один простейший пример можно привести и с другими приложениями. Например, чтобы постоянно не подгружать какие-либо элементы из меню и медиафайлы (картинки, аудио и прочее) с серверов, программа загружает эти данные 1 раз и сохраняет их в памяти. Последующие запуски будут проходить быстрее и в целом быстродействие значительно увеличится.
Но существует и другие кэш-файлы, которые нельзя удалять. Это особенно актуально для «тяжелых» приложений и игр, которые значительную часть своих данных хранят в виде одного увесистого файла. Если его удалить, программа перестанет работать и в лучшем случае предлагает загрузить недостающие данные.
Есть ли смысл в очистке кэша
На самом деле это очень правильный и актуальный вопрос, учитывая то, сколько «клинеров» сейчас существует для Android, способных очистить устройство от мусора. Но нужно понимать, что кэш-файлы того или иного приложения создаются в системе постоянно, пока мы пользуемся им. И даже если мы удалим кэш, например, у Google Chrome, уже через пару минут после запуска браузера файл будет создан снова, разве что с меньшим, но постоянно растущим размером.
Почему так происходит? В этом заключается сама суть технологии. Каждая программа/браузер использует кэширование. Как мы уже говорили, после запуска приложение анализирует ту область памяти, в которую она сохраняет кэш. И если в данной области программа находит необходимую в этот момент времени информацию, то просто считывает ее и продолжает работу.
Но что происходит после того, как мы очистили кэш? Сохраненная информация пропадает с диска, и приложение вновь записывает в условно ту же область памяти новые данные (кэш). И размер кэша раз за разом будет увеличиваться. Мы можем лишь удалить его, чтобы получить выгоду единожды и сэкономить какое-либо количество памяти, которое нам нужно именно сейчас. Но в долгосрочной перспективе сэкономить не получится – кэширование работает всегда. А значит рано или поздно удаленный нами кэш с условным размером в 600 Мб накопится снова.
Встроенные методы
Здесь рассмотрим все варианты очистки кэш-файлов без установки дополнительного софта. Будем пользоваться только теми возможностями, которыми обладает система Android.
Удаляем кэш в диспетчере приложений
Начнем с самого простого и безопасного способа, который подойдет для любого пользователя.
Шаг 1. Открываем приложение «Настройки», после чего переходим в раздел «Приложения и уведомления» (также может называться «Приложения» и пр.).
Шаг 2. Нажимаем на строку «Показать все приложения» и открываем полный список установленных программ.
Шаг 3. Отсекаем встроенные (предустановленные производителем) и необходимые для работы устройства программы, разворачивая список и выбирая фильтр «Установленные приложения».
Шаг 4. Если некоторые системные утилиты еще присутствуют в списке (например, «Галерея», «Служба NFC», «Словарь пользователя» и другие сервисы), то нажимаем на «три точки» в верхнем правом углу и выбираем опцию «Скрыть системные процессы».
Шаг 5. Выбираем любую программу из списка и нажимаем на нее. Далее переходим в раздел «Хранилище» и получаем подробную информацию о занимаемом пространстве: размер приложения, данные пользователя и кэш.
Шаг 6. Нажимаем на кнопку «Очистить кэш» (но не трогаем «Стереть данные»!).
Шаг 7. Повторяем шаги 5-6 с остальными программами и таким образом освобождаем приличное количество внутренней памяти.
Обратите внимание! В зависимости от установленной на устройстве версии операционной системы Android и оболочки (MIUI, Oxygen OS, EMUI OS и пр.) пункты меню могут отличаться от тех, что описаны в инструкции выше. Для написания использовалась «чистая» (AOSP) версия Android 9.0.
Пользуемся файловым менеджером
В отличие от предыдущего метода данный вариант является более сложным, так как здесь необходимо понимать, какие файлы можно удалять, а какие – нет. Учитывая, что чистить кэш можно нажатием нескольких кнопок в настройках устройства, способ нельзя назвать действительно полезным, но мы все же для полного освещения картины кратко ознакомимся с ним.
Шаг 1. Находим стандартный файловый менеджер и открываем его. Если это приложение «Файлы», открываем боковое меню свайпом вправо с левого края экрана и переходим во внутреннюю память.
Шаг 2. Среди списка папок переходим по пути «Android» – «data».
Шаг 3. Именно здесь хранятся кэш-файлы, которые можно удалять. Здесь находится большое количество папок, каждая из которых принадлежит одному установленному в системе приложению. Выделяем любую и жмем на значок корзины для удаления.
Один большой недостаток этого способа – он абсолютно не подойдет неопытному пользователю. Если вы не знаете, как устроена вся «кухня» изнутри и не понимаете, что обозначает вся та куча папок, лучше воспользоваться простым диспетчером приложений, так как вы можете случайно удалить не только кэш, но и остальные важные данные.
Пользуемся программами для очистки
На просторах Интернета и в официальном магазине Google Play есть множество утилит, которые предлагают довольно широкий функционал по очистке системы от мусора. Они позволяют удалять не только кэш (при этом абсолютно безопасно и не удаляя остальных важных данных без вашего разрешения), но и искать мусор другого типа – файлы-дубликаты. Это гораздо более автоматизированный, простой и эффективный способ. Разберем несколько популярных утилит для очистки.
Рассмотрим весь процесс на примере программы SD Maid. Она давно зарекомендовала себя в качестве эффективной утилиты по очистке мусора и освобождению памяти.
Шаг 1. Переходим по ссылке на форум 4PDA (потребуется регистрация) и скачиваем программу на устройство (выбираем любую из двух версий). Устанавливаем SD Maid.
Шаг 2. Запускаем приложение и нажимаем на кнопку «Сканирование».
Шаг 3. Предоставляем разрешения на доступ к внутренней памяти, SD-Card (если установлена) и получению статистики использования.
Шаг 4. По окончании процесса сканирования начинаем удаление нажатием на кнопку «Запустить сейчас».
Кроме очистки кэша приложений и поиска мусора у программы есть и другой полезный функционал. Например, ее можно использовать в качестве файлового менеджера или диспетчера приложений. Также, она умеет анализировать внутренний и внешний накопители на устройстве и выводить статистику занятой и свободной памяти по разделам. Кроме того, SD Maid умеет сжимать и оптимизировать базы данных установленных приложения для повышения быстродействия.
А при желании в настройках можно установить специальное расписание, в рамках которого утилита будет автоматически производить чистку системы. После каждой чистки будет формироваться история и подробный отчет с диаграммой.
Из других подобных программ хочется отметить CCleaner от разработчика Piriform. Это также зарекомендовавшая себя утилита, которая перебралась еще с десктопной платформы и была давно известна пользователям Windows. По функционалу она может несколько проигрывать SD Maid, но также эффективно находит мусор. Огромный плюс в копилку ей добавляется и за интуитивно понятный интерфейс, в котором разберется любой пользователь.
Заключение
Кэш-файлы – своего рода источник мусора (если рассматривать их с точки зрения количества занимаемой памяти и пользы), который размножается в системе пропорционально тому, сколько приложений вы устанавливаете на свое устройство. Но не стоит воспринимать кэш как нечто бесполезное. Он позволяет повысить быстродействие программы, ускорить ее запуск и увеличить плавность работы.
Кэш может занимать от нескольких десятков мегабайт до нескольких гигабайт памяти. И вся проблема в том, что после очистки таких файлов, они будут накапливаться снова и снова. В этом суть процесса кэширования. Возможно, воспользовавшись способами, описанными выше, вы удивитесь от того, сколько памяти было занято приложениями, установленными на вашем устройстве.
При очистке следует пользоваться либо встроенными инструментами (диспетчер приложений), либо проверенными и эффективными утилитами, предназначенными как раз для этой задачи. Избегайте сомнительных программ с низким рейтингом, которые предлагают схожий с SD Maid или CCleaner функционал.
Источник